Maxine Brody

May 22, 1923 — December 3, 2011

Sibley, IA Maxine Brody, age 88 of Bigelow, MN died Saturday, December 3, 2011 at the Country View Manor in Sibley, IA. Memorial service will be 11:00 a.m. Wednesday, December 7, 2011 at the United Methodist Church in Sibley, with Pastor Shannon Pascual officiating. Private burial for family will take place prior to the service in the Ocheyedan Township Cemetery in Ocheyedan, IA. Visitation will be Tuesday, December 6th from 2-8 p.m. with the family present from 6-8 p.m. at the Jurrens Funeral Home of Sibley. Maxine (Creech) Brody was born on May 22, 1923 in Argyle, MO, the daughter of Paul and Marie Creech. She attended Sibley High School. On June 16, 1943, she was united in marriage to Don Brody in Worthington, MN; while Don was on military furlough. When Don returned from the war they started farming and after a few years they moved to a farm just off highway 59 north of Allendorf, IA. Max enjoyed being a housewife and loved being a mother to their five children. She liked to read books, play pinochle and spend time with her family and friends. On December 3, 2011 at the age of 88, Max went to be with her Lord and Savior Jesus Christ. Max is survived by the love of her life and husband, Don; son, Dale Brody (and his wife Lavonne) of Blue Springs, MO; three daughters, Donna Batye of Kansas City, MO, Diane Duggan (and her husband John) of Kansas City, MO and Nancy Henderson of Plymouth, MN; 12 grandchildren, 25 great-grandchildren and 5 great-great-grandchildren; two sisters-in-law, Bobbie Truckenmiller (and her husband Dennis) of Sibley, IA and Carol Creech of Alexandria, VA; and many nieces and nephews. She was preceded in death by her parents, Paul and Marie Creech; parents-in-law, Gordon and Clara Brody; one son, Craig Brody; one brother, Bill Creech; one sister, Louise Voight (and her husband Gene); two sisters-in-law, Darlene Alexander (and her husband Ray) and Joyceln Deaver (and her husband Leonard). Her greatest love and joy was her family and she will be greatly missed by all of them.
